Yes, steak is generally denser than chicken. This is due to the differences in muscle composition and fat content between the two types of meat. Steak typically contains more myoglobin, which contributes to its density, while chicken has a higher water content and less myoglobin, making it lighter in comparison. However, the exact density can vary depending on the specific cut and preparation of each meat.
